Jordag - Churchu, Hazaribagh

Jordag is a village situated in the Churchu subdivision of Hazaribagh district, Jharkhand. It is located approximately 3 km from the tehsil headquarters in Churchu and around 30 km from the district headquarters in Hazaribagh. Churchu serves as the Gram Panchayat for Jordag village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Jordag is 368881. The village covers a total geographical area of 250.44 hectares and falls under the 825303 pincode. Hazaribagh is the nearest town.

Jordag village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.

Population of Jordag

As per Census 2011, Jordag village has a total population of 421 people, consisting of 211 males and 210 females. The village has 81 households and a sex ratio of 995 females per 1,000 males. There are 85 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 243 literate and 178 illiterate residents. Additionally, 125 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 149 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Jordag

Jordag is connected by an all-weather road, while public transport facilities are available within <1 km of the village. The nearest railway station is Danea, while the nearest airport is Birsa Munda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 53.4 km.
